Historical Exchange Rate Trends
Tracking historical data allows users to identify patterns and make informed predictions about future movements in the MYR/LKR pair.
Recent Daily Rates (June – July 2025)
- July 1, 2025: 1 MYR = 71.4971 LKR
- June 30, 2025: 1 MYR = 71.1848 LKR
- June 29, 2025: 1 MYR = 70.8920 LKR
- June 28, 2025: 1 MYR = 70.8919 LKR
- June 27, 2025: 1 MYR = 70.8925 LKR
- June 26, 2025: 1 MYR = 70.8226 LKR
- June 25, 2025: 1 MYR = 70.7683 LKR
- June 24, 2025: 1 MYR = 70.8812 LKR
- June 23, 2025: 1 MYR = 70.7065 LKR
- June 22, 2025: 1 MYR = 70.6692 LKR
Over this ten-day period, the exchange rate has fluctuated within a narrow band between 70.67 and 71.50, indicating relative stability with slight volatility likely influenced by regional economic developments.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: How often is the MYR to LKR exchange rate updated?
A: The exchange rate is refreshed every minute to reflect live market conditions, ensuring users receive the most accurate and current data possible.
Q: Is it better to exchange money in Malaysia or Sri Lanka?
A: It’s generally advisable to compare both local banks and airport exchange counters in both countries. While some travelers prefer exchanging a small amount in advance for immediate expenses, better rates are often available through local banks or ATMs upon arrival.
Q: What factors affect the MYR to LKR exchange rate?
A: Key influences include inflation rates, interest rate policies by Bank Negara Malaysia and the Central Bank of Sri Lanka, trade balances, tourism flows, and global economic sentiment affecting emerging market currencies.
Q: Can I use Malaysian Ringgit in Sri Lanka?
A: No. The official currency in Sri Lanka is the Sri Lankan Rupee (LKR). Foreign currencies like the MYR are not accepted for everyday transactions. You must convert your Ringgit to Rupees before or upon arrival.
Q: Are there any fees when converting MYR to LKR?
A: Yes. Banks and currency exchange services typically apply a margin or service fee on top of the base exchange rate. Always check the total cost before making a transaction.
